The transition from the general management systems standard ISO 9001:2008 to the new 2015 revision is a critical concern among industry professionals, especially as the 2018 deadline approaches.
To help organizations be better prepared, a gap analysis is recommended to fully assess the areas that require attention prior to a final recertification audit. Areas of focus include an evaluation of core processes, leadership, planning, support, operation and improvement. Professional recommendations for improvement allow these organizations to avoid issues and delays further in the process.
Pro QC’s Regional Director in North America, Jennifer Stepniowski, cites a “notable increase in inquiries from small to medium-sized companies concerned about issues with compliance to the new revision. There’s a focus on risk-based thinking and leadership over traditional management. It’s a shift in thinking that many organizations just aren’t ready for. The World Conference on Quality and Improvement just wrapped up, and the 2015 transition was definitely the hot topic.”
Over one million companies and organizations worldwide are already registered to ISO 9001. Noted results from Dallas Business Journal report that 85% of ISO registered firms report external benefits like higher perceived quality, greater customer demand, better market differentiation, greater employee awareness, increased operational efficiency and reduced scrap expense.
The benefits of the 2015 revision include more flexibility with documentation, increase in structured planning for setting objectives, greater focus on achieving conforming products and services and increased opportunities to integrate other standard elements such as environmental, health and safety, etc.
